An Imari charger
19th Century
Painted with a large central scene of two ladies arranging flowers in an interior setting, the border enamelled with numerous cranes in flight reserved on an iron-red ground, the reverse with clusters of peony, chrysanthemum and plum alternated by butterflies
46.1 cm. diam.
